Warranty Corrections Sample Clauses

Warranty Corrections. Cause to be enforced (short of instituting any legal proceeding) all warranties and guaranties of the General Contractor or materialmen with a view to correcting any known or identified defects in the construction of the Project or in the installation or operation of any equipment or fixtures therein, at the expense of the General Contractor or materialmen and cause inspections of the completed Project to be made by the Project Architect with a view to discovering any such defects.

Warranty Corrections. As applicable during the ongoing construction of the Project, Xxxxxxxx shall enforce all warranties and guaranties of manufacturers supplying materials and equipment used in construction of the Project, and warranties and guaranties of the General Contractor and its subcontractors and materialmen specified in their respective contracts, to correct any known or identified defects in the construction of the Project or in the installation or operation of any equipment or fixtures therein.
Warranty Corrections. If, within one (1) year after the date of Completion of the interior finishes or a designated portion thereof, within two (2) years after the date of Completion of the exterior finishes and/or mechanical, electrical, and plumbing installation, or after the date for commencement of warranties established hereunder, or by the terms of an applicable special warranty required by the Contract Documents, any of the Work is found to be not in accordance with the requirements of the Contract Documents, the Developer shall correct it promptly after receipt of written notice from the District to do so. The respective one (1) and two (2) year periods shall be extended with respect to portions of the Work first performed after Completion by the period of time between Completion and the actual performance of the Work. This obligation hereunder shall survive District’s acceptance of the Work under the Contract Documents and termination of the Contract Documents. The District shall give such notice promptly after discovery of the condition.
